Alabama passes Ohio State for most weeks at No. 1 in AP poll
Alabama owns another crown in college football.
No, the College Football Playoff committee didn’t forego the remainder of the 2018 season and ship the trophy to Tuscaloosa with Nick Saban’s name on the envelope. This crown is more of an unofficial thing, but it’s still a college football thing.
After maintaining its status as college football’s No. 1 team in the latest Associated Press poll, Alabama owns the record for most weeks ranked in the No. 1 spot, passing Ohio State for the honor.
The Crimson Tide have now sat atop the college football rankings for a record-setting 106 times since the poll began ranking teams in 1936. A good chunk of those 106 weeks at No. 1 have been with Nick Saban leading the charge.
Saban’s teams have been ranked No. 1 nationally 75 times, which would rank sixth all-time by itself, according to ESPN.
Ohio State is currently ranked No. 4 in the most recent AP poll, which was released on Sunday.
